Need your input please. I am interested in purchasing an electronic ignition for my BJ7. Which is preferred, the Petronix or the Crane?

Thanks,

Ray
 
Ray, I prefer the Pertronix unit because of its simplicity,ease of installation,no excessive wiring running around in the engine compartment and good value for the money.--FWIW---Keoke Plus you can switch back to points as quick as a /ubbthreads/images/graemlins/wink.gif
 
Ray I have a pertronix in my BT7 and it works just great, I also have one in my 1965 Ford truck that I pull the Kart racing trailer with and it has worked flawlessly for over 5 years now. Skip
 
If you are not concerned with original appearance and want to avoid the problems associated with Lucas caps and rotors check out Mallory's product. They have two electronic systems--the Maglite and Unilite. Century Performance offers Unilite model #4767801 with vacuum advance--not sure how their tach drive models work but check it out at: www.centuryperformance.com and see the model for either TR6 or Jags w/out fuel injection. They work on our cars. BTW Century's prices are way below that asked by Moss for Mallory stuff.
 
Ray, I use the Pertronix in combination with a Mallory dis and had no problems with it since using it for a year now.

Advantages: all the prementioned advantages plus a good availability for spares like dis cap and rotor for reasonable prices. Mallory dis is a quick and easy replacement installation, even for a amateur mechanic like me and the whole thing can be reverted in less than an hour.

Disadvantage: not the original look, but see advantages....

I bought the Mallory from Denis Welch in the UK. He delivers it with an additional, strengthened drive dog at extra cost.
